I went through 2 of them before I remote mounted it. No problems since.

When the first one went only had the gauges for about 1 1/2 yrs. Called Glow Shift and they sent me one free even though I was out of warranty. They recommended to mount it remotely if possible but if not at least go from a horizontal mount to vertical. The second one went about 6 months later even though I added a 90 fitting and mounted vertically.

The second one only cost about 15 bucks and I finally remote mounted it to the firewall. No more engine vibes killing the sender and still good 6 years later.

I killed a FP sensor from ISSPRO. Same readings as you had on yours Timmy.

ISSPRO sent me a new sensor and a snubber for free. No problems since then and it has been a couple years at least.
